Artist Registry
The White Columns Curated Artist Registry is an online platform for emerging and under-recognized artists to share images and information about their respective practices. The Registry seeks to create a context for artists who have yet to benefit from wider critical, curatorial or commercial support. To be eligible, artists cannot be affiliated with a commercial gallery in New York City.

STATEMENT OF WORK
My work explores joy with weight—how movement, play, and buoyancy can emerge through density, pressure, and accumulation rather than escape. I am interested in paintings that feel both grounded and lifted, where scale, color, and structure generate motion.
Through layering and reconfiguration, images gather and loosen at the same time. Color creates rhythm, momentum, and pause. Many works carry an upward energy that does not deny gravity, holding air alongside density. The work insists on motion rather than resolution, keeping pressure and lightness in active negotiation.
